pip install junitparser
examples/python/junit/parse_junit.py
import os
from junitparser import JUnitXml, Failure, Skipped, Error
import tempfile
import subprocess
def qxx(cmd):
proc = subprocess.Popen(cmd,
stdout = subprocess.PIPE,
stderr = subprocess.PIPE,
shell = True,
)
stdout, stderr = proc.communicate()
return proc.returncode, stdout, stderr
def main():
tmpdir = tempfile.mkdtemp(prefix='test_reports')
print(tmpdir)
path = 'cases'
cases = os.listdir(path)
for case in cases:
#print(case)
if case != 'c.py':
continue
xml_file = os.path.join(tmpdir, f"{case}.xml")
cmd_list = ['pytest', os.path.join(path, case), '--junitxml', xml_file]
code, stdout, stderr = qxx(cmd_list)
if code !=0:
print(f"Execution failed with {code}")
print(stdout)
print(stderr)
exit(1)
with open(xml_file) as fh:
print(fh.read())
return
xml = JUnitXml.fromfile(xml_file)
for suite in xml:
#print(suite)
for case in suite:
#print(type(case))
print(case.name)
if case.result:
print(case.result)
if isinstance(case.result, Failure):
print(' failure ', case.result.message)
if isinstance(case.result, Skipped):
print(' skipped ', case.result.message)
main()
examples/python/junit/cases/a.py
def test_good():
assert 1 == 1
def test_bad():
assert 2 == 3
examples/python/junit/cases/b.py
def test_happy():
assert 4 == 4
examples/python/junit/cases/c.py
import pytest
@pytest.mark.skip("This is going to be skipped")
def test_skipper():
x = 10 / 0
@pytest.mark.xfail(reason="So we can check xfail that fails")
def test_known_bug():
assert 7 == 8
@pytest.mark.xfail(reason="So we can check xfail that succeeds")
def test_fixed_bug():
assert 10 == 10
